<p>Sasha Banks <a href="http://sports.nbcsports.com/2017/12/21/sasha-banks-on-2018-royal-rumble-future-of-womens-wrestling-becoming-face-of-wwe/" target="new">spoke with NBC Sports</a> about the upcoming Women’s Royal Rumble. Here are some highlights from the interview:</p>
<p><b>Role she wants to have in the women’s Royal Rumble:</b> “I don’t know if I would want to start off first. I would have to do extra cardio to prepare and with the holiday season I’ve been eating a lot, so I don’t know if I would be ready for that … just kidding (laughs). Honestly, I would rather get that lucky number 30 and throw everyone out that’s left. I don’t want to sweat my makeup off. I want to look good! But no, I haven’t seriously thought about it or had a chance to because I’m still kind of in that shock moment and I’ve been more thinking about what legend could be in the match or if we’ll have girls from NXT be in the match because with [the] SmackDown and Raw [rosters] we don’t have enough to get to that 30 number yet. The potential of what legend can I work has me more excited than which number I’ll be in the Royal Rumble match, but I think when I get closer to the actual Royal Rumble, that’s when I’ll get more of my nerves. I don’t want to say I’m in shock because I guessed that this would happen, but it’s still so crazy to kick off 2018 knowing that the women are going to have a Royal Rumble match at the Royal Rumble. It’s really cool.”</p>
<p><b>Which former WWE stars she’d like to see come back for the women’s Royal Rumble:</b> “I would love to hear Trish Stratus’ music. Of course Lita, Molly Holly, Jazz, Jacqueline, man even Victoria. It would be an honor to be in the ring with any of those girls. Beth Phoenix. Of course I want to win it, but at the same time, I would just want her to pick me up and throw me over the top. I would mark out, but I would land on my hands and go back into the ring like Kofi Kingston (laughs). Any of those girls would be incredible, but of course I would love to see girls from NXT get the opportunity, but of course they wouldn’t win it because I would be the last person standing.”</p>
<p><b>The storyline dictating when a women’s match will main event Wrestlemania:</b>“Exactly and that’s the number one thing is. I don’t just want something to be given to us just to put that little stamp like ‘Oh look the women are doing it now it’s cool.’ No. My goal is to main event WrestleMania and if we’re going to main event it, I need it to be the greatest storyline ever. I need the fans to be invested. I just don’t want to get handed something because they’re putting a first time ever [match] for women. I want it to be a good storyline and I want the crowd to care because those are the moments that…I feel like the reason people talk about the Brooklyn match [I had] with Bayley so much is because of the history between me and Bayley. You know that she fought from the very beginning to get the women’s championship and for me, I fought to keep that and to show people that I’m the best. People are invested in the storylines more than just putting a name on something and bam! First time ever, you know what I mean?”</p>

<p>While speaking to <a href="http://sportingnews.com/" rel="noopener" target="_blank">Sporting News</a>, Alexa Bliss was asked about how she feels about working on Christmas this year and mentioned that she is going to try to make the best of it.</p>
<p><em>“Honestly, I didn’t really have an opinion on it. [Laughs] It’s what we do. This is our job and no matter what day it falls on we have to do our job. I know some people were not too happy about it — the people that have families and stuff like that — but it’s work. It’s what we have to do. We signed up for it. I don’t really have an opinion on it. I just figured I’d make the best of it.” </em></p>
<p>As previously reported, historically WWE normally tapes Holiday episode of WWE programming to allow talents to have time off to spend with their families. This year WWE decided against it and will now broadcast live for Christmas and The New Years.</p>

<p>The Young Bucks indicated on Twitter that the use of the crotch chop, which was made famous by D-Generation X in the late 90s, would no longer be permitted by WWE after they received a cease &#038; desist notice from WWE. They discussed the letter on episode 68 of The Elite.</p>

<p>WWE is offering an amazing two-for-one ticket deal for the upcoming RAW &#038; SmackDown events that falls on a holiday week.</p>
<p>Apparently the company believes that it will be hard to push ticket sales for the July 3rd and 4th episodes of RAW and SmackDown because it will be a holiday week so they are giving the fans a deal that is too good to pass up. The events will be held at the Talking Stick Resort Arena in Phoenix, AZ.</p>
